Can a video about mood make you want to work out?

NCT ID NCT06706180

Summary

This study tested if a short video focusing on exercise for improving mood could motivate people to exercise more than a video focusing on exercise for fitness. Researchers worked with 48 stressed college students, showing them one of the two videos and then checking their motivation and exercise habits about two weeks later. The goal was to find a better way to help people stick with regular exercise.
